When I install the newest Cygwin 32 on Windows XP the
install process hangs on cmake-debuginfo-3.3.2-1.
The system seems to hang in an infinite loop with
setup.exe drawing 99% of the CPU.
Please note that the download and SHA checksum
check seem to complete successfully.
Please note that I am running Windows XP SP3 with
with the current updates installed.
Is there a way to work around this bug and complete
the install manually?

It would be more worthwhile to create a new install in a separate directory,
and start small.
Only install base set of packages.
Then gradually add tools you need.
I don't know, why you are installing -debuginfo packages, but it is IMO
unlikely to cause issues by itself.
Sounds more like environmental issue, or issue triggered immediately following
the installation of the mentioned package.
